CRON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2023 in Review
170 of the 6,859 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Cronos Group (CRON) for Q4 2023, worth a combined $70.3M — up 16% from $60.7M a quarter earlier.
Buyers outnumbered sellers: 31 funds opened new CRON positions and 21 closed out — a net gain of 10 holders — while 36 added to existing stakes and 36 trimmed.
The largest buyer was Susquehanna International Group, adding an estimated $1.48M. The largest seller was D.E. Shaw & Co, cutting an estimated $766K.
